>> I'm trying to add a function in the msgsum.html (mail summary)
>> so far i have a icon beside each msg listed, when clicked it
>> calls a function defined at the top of the page.
>>
>> Here's what I have "working", all it does is just show me that
>> its getting the data.
>>
>> document.write('<!--IMAIL.CurrentDomain--> <!--IMAIL.UserID-->
>> <!--IMAIL.CurrentMailBox-->'+inpt)
>>
>> Now the problem I run in to is when I wish to display (of
>> anything) the msg header of the selected msgs I get ziltch.
>>
>> Is it possible to use Tags like
>> "<!--IMAIL.MailMessageWithHeader-->" on the msgsum page? if so how :)
>
>Two things:
>
>- The IMAIL.MailMessageWithHeader tag only works when displaying a single
>message (like on the readmail.html page), not in the middle of the message
>list.
>
>- Remember that JavaScript doesn't handle carriage returns well, so you
>could never do something like :
>
> document.write('<!--IMAIL.MailMessageWithHeader-->');
>
>because the JS statement would break at the first CR.
